The Wetband's avatar
Woody's first adventure in didgeridoo recording. Features bass through a keyboard and a tsamiko rhythm drum loop. Tsamiko is a popular traditional dance of Greece. The rhythm seemed to suit the didgeridoo quite well and inspired this piece.

igor's avatar
This piece is an illustration of one of the episodes of a Russian fairy tale about a little brave Humpbacked Horse. Instruments used: blues harp (harmonica), classical guitar and some bells-and-whistles. Narrated by Svetlana.
